profiler said:
can you copy the whole email here... remove the personal info... it's a form letter so, there is nothing other than you name/application number.

This letter refers to your application for permanent residence under the Spouse or Common-law
Partner in Canada class.
In order to continue processing your application, further information is required. You must
complete/submit the following to this office:

> Medical: Complete or provide proof of completion of the Immigration Medical
Examination. Immigration legislation requires that all applicants for permanent residence and their
family members if applicable complete medical examinations. The required medical forms and
instructions have been sent by mail or e-mail to the address provided on your original application
form. This must be received at this office by: 2017/06/01
> Schedule A:You have submitted an incomplete Schedule A Background / Declaration
(IMM5669) form(s). When filling out this form, you must provide details for every month and year since
the age of 18 or the past 10 years from the date on which your application was received, whichever is
most recent. There can be no gaps in this period of time. You may obtain this form at:
"IMM5669E.pdf". This must be received at this office by:
2017/06/01
> Additional Family Info IMM5406: A separate and newly completed Additional Family
Information form (IMM5406) bearing original signatures. This must be received at this office by:
2017/06/01
IMPORTANT: If your documents are not in English or French, send a notarized (certified) translation
with a copy of the original version. To have a photocopy of a document certified, an authorized
person must compare the original document to the photocopy. Neither you nor your family members
may certify copies of your documents.
All requested documents/information and a copy of this correspondence must be submitted within the
timeframes specified above (formatted as “year/month/day”). If you are unable to provide any or all of
the requested documents/information, please explain why they are not available. No other reminder
will be sent to you. If you fail to provide the requested information, your application will be assessed
on the basis of the information that we have which may result in the refusal of your application for
permanent residence. Should this occur, no further consideration will be given to your request for
permanent residence unless a new application, including fees, is submitted.

profiler said:
WHOOPS

Yes

IMM5406 + Schedule A == the basis of the information in your immigration file. You had a date problem. As such, both are required to redo. Surprised it's this late tbh, but just do it up (PA only) and submit the pair.

Medical, sorry, unless you are a robot, you must do it.

In Question 8 on the Schedule A it states: Provide the details of our personal history since the age of 18 or the past 10 years, it also states that if you were outside your country of nationality, indicate your status in that country.

Does this mean i have to provide details of every single country i have visited since the age of 18 (which is more recent for me), even if it was just a short 1-2 day holiday?

And if that is so, would i have to provide the address of the hotels in the last question where it states mention all your addresses you lived at?

aslampip said:
In Question 8 on the Schedule A it states: Provide the details of our personal history since the age of 18 or the past 10 years, it also states that if you were outside your country of nationality, indicate your status in that country.

Does this mean i have to provide details of every single country i have visited since the age of 18 (which is more recent for me), even if it was just a short 1-2 day holiday?

And if that is so, would i have to provide the address of the hotels in the last question where it states mention all your addresses you lived at?
Max 10 years. If you are under 28, then everything since 18.

Yes, everything.

You can use another piece of paper formatted like the table they have created and just paperclip it.
